    The original RazoRock Lupo was such a hit with our clients that we decided it was time to create a "gen two" version milled from marine-grade stainless steel. We listened to your feedback from the aluminum Lupo and took it to the design board to come up with a razor that is even better! The three most popular suggestions were; a) You wanted the razor to be able to rest on the side of its head while still keeping the guard width the same as the width of the blade for excellent maneuverability; b) You wanted more optionality in terms of aggression, and; c) Many of you suggested a scalloped bar would add a nice aesthetic touch!

    We delivered on all three suggestions and now the RazoRock SS Lupo is NOW available in SIX different versions,

    1. Lupo 58 - a 0.58 mm safety bar
    2. Lupo 72 - a 0.72 mm safety bar
    3. Lupo OPEN COMB 72 - a 0.72 mm Open Comb for those seeking a lot more aggression and efficiency - Same gap and exposure as Safety Bar 72 but will be slightly more aggressive due to the Open Comb design
    4. Lupo 95 - a 0.95 mm safety bar for those seeking a lot more aggression and efficiency
    5. Lupo OPEN COMB 95 - a 0.95 mm Open Comb for those seeking a lot more aggression and efficiency - Same gap and exposure as Safety Bar 95 but will be slightly more aggressive due to the Open Comb design
    6. Lupo DC - a 0.72/0.95 dual-comb version which offers a medium-aggressive open comb side and a more aggressive safety bar side.

      Blade Gap: 0.72 mm

      Blade Exposure: Positive

      Material: 316L Marine Grade Stainless Steel

      Build: Fully CNC machined

      Finish: 3 stage, 24 hour, machine vibratory finish. It's important to note that our finish is designed to de-burr and make the pieces smooth with minimum effect on machining tolerances. It's a tool-like finish and not a mirror-type high polish; each piece is unique (no two pieces will be identical). We don't believe in hand polishing our machined safety razors because it's self-defeating. We spend so much time and effort getting the tolerances tight, a hand polish will just ruin these tolerances. We would rather give you a quality tool-like finish at a great price and leave it up to you if you want to put a jewelry type polish or gun-kote at the razor later at additional cost.

      Other Details: Each razor is engraved with a unique serial number.

      Made in Canada
